UPVC hinges can be manufactured in a variety of designs and are used to connect a door frame with sash. They are designed to hold weight and provide smooth operation. UPVC hinges are available in a variety of sizes and materials. It's important to select the appropriate one for your needs.

The most common uPVC hinges are referred to as butt hinges. They are made up of two hinge leaves (or plates) and the hinge pin. Both of the hinge leaves have holes for screws, which help them remain in position. The hinge pin is attached through the knuckles, and assists in keeping both plates together.

The security and function of your door will depend on the kind of hinge you choose. The three most popular types are butt, rebated and flag hinges. Flag hinges are attached to the edge of the door, while butt hinges are installed into the door frame. Rebated hinges are difficult to find in the market, but they can be installed easily and adjusted.

Use a fixation jig to make sure that the sash is correctly positioned on the frame. It is recommended also to test the weight of each of the three hinges. Once you are satisfied that the sash is weighed equally on all hinges, you can start fitting it onto the door.

Install x3 hinges for flags onto an existing uPVC shash. The top hinge should be placed 150mm from the top of the sash, the bottom hinge should be placed 150mm away from the bottom edge and the middle hinge should be placed equally between the two outer friction hinges for upvc windows.

There are many different types of uPVC door hinges on the market, and each has its own unique features. The kind of hinge you choose will depend on your needs and budget. uPVC doors are commonly fitted with T, butt and flag hinges. Flag hinges are the most commonly used and are found on modern uPVC door. These hinges are designed to support a heavier sash, and permit horizontal and vertical adjustments.

T hinges are similar to flag hinges and they can be adjusted horizontally or vertically. Butt hinges, on the other hand, are usually found on older doors and are only capable of being adjusted laterally.
